There is a more definitive macrophage antibody for mature mouse macs, it's
name is F4/80 and is available from Caltag Laboratories. It comes in many
flavors of color.

>	I would like to confidently enumerating monocytes and granulocytes
> in mouse marrow and peripheral blood. I am currently using MAC-1 and GR-1,
> however the combination does not clearly separate the myeloid cells from
> each other. Does anyone have suggestions about other antibodies, markers, or
> methods that can be used for this purpose?
